F1 won’t race in Russia after Ukraine invasion

LONDON (AP) — Formula One has pulled its race from Russia following the country’s invasion of Ukraine, saying Friday it would be “impossible” to hold the race in Sochi under the current circumstances.The Russian Grand Prix had been scheduled for Sept. 25.

Former Houston Oilers receiver Ken Burrough dies at 73

HOUSTON (AP) — Ken Burrough, the former Houston Oilers receiver who was the last NFL player to wear No. 00, died Thursday. He was 73.Burrough’s family announced the death, saying he died at his home in Jacksonville, Florida.

SWOSU Lady Bulldogs hold steady in latest regional rankings

WEATHERFORD, Okla. – The No. 19-ranked Lady Bulldogs remain in the fourth spot of the Central Region rankings released Wednesday by the NCAA. SWOSU is 24-4 on the season and has played all 28 of their contests against in-region opponents.
